Senior Software Engineer, Electromagnetic Pulse (EMP)

Sorry, this job was removed at 3:33 a.m. (PST) on Tuesday, December 21, 2021
Find out who's hiring in Greater LA Area.
See all Developer + Engineer jobs in Greater LA Area
Apply
By clicking Apply Now you agree to share your profile information with the hiring company.

Epirus is the creator of a revolutionary electromagnetic pulse (EMP) technology designed for protecting the world's skies and airspaces from Unmanned Airborne Vehicles (a.k.a “drones”). Among counter-drone solutions, our technology is unique in its capability to disable entire swarms of drones quickly and effectively. The core innovation behind this marvel is Epirus’s SmartPower(TM), an intelligent power system that optimizes power-efficiency and dramatically reduces size. At Epirus, we’re on a journey to push the boundaries of what’s possible for the future of power electronics.

About the opportunity

In this role, you’ll build the brains behind Leonidas, our EMP-based counter-drone system. Here are some of the interesting things you might find yourself working on:

  • Real-time coordination of hundreds of intelligent power-amplified modules over web-based services

  • Programming hundreds of antennae in synchronicity to form a concentrated energy beam directed at a moving target

  • Evolving a modern embedded software platform that utilizes Embedded Linux, open-source software, and web-based microservices

  • System management software to safely bring up, shutdown, and monitor a sophisticated system of electronic components

What you’ll bring to the table

  • 3-10 years coding professionally in a modern systems programming language such as C++, Java, or Rust

  • A firm grasp of Data Structures, Algorithms, Design Patterns, and other Computer Science fundamentals

What makes you an exceptional candidate

  • 4+ years professional software engineering experience

  • Experience developing low-level software for embedded systems, hardware control, robotics, etc.

  • Direct experience with Embedded Linux and related development/build tools

  • An understanding of computing performance and an ability to optimize software performance in large or distributed systems

  • Knowledge of multi-threading, parallelism, and concurrency; an ability to produce thread-safe software modules that cooperate well together

 

Epirus was the magical bow with infinite arrows wielded by the Greek hero Theseus. Like our namesake, we strive to be fast, efficient, and limitless in our approach. This agility, combined with a culture of innovation in systems development, allows us to move quickly without losing the decades of lessons learned.

 

We have developed technologies that leverage new breakthroughs in sensors and high-power microwaves, combined with computer vision and advanced software control. Our first broad-market application is a comprehensive defense system to defeat offensive drones at scale.

Read Full Job Description
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.

Location

Our company is located in Torrance, just off of the 405. We moved into our new 100,000+ square foot facility in November 2021 and love calling it home.

Similar Jobs

Apply Now
By clicking Apply Now you agree to share your profile information with the hiring company.
Learn more about EpirusFind similar jobs